Study on the application of immobilized yeast in in Chinese liquor fermentation

Traditional technology for Chinese liquor production was partially changed using immobilized yeast fermentation technique and further investigated.The results showed that both alcohol yield and ethanol producing rate increased 3% with no effect on original wine flavor and other physical and chemical parameters by the use of immobilized yeast compared with the use of free yeast in fermentation.
